MD (Doctor of Medicine)
MD is the most popular course after bachelor-of-medicine-and-bachelor-of-surgery (MBBS) for students who like non-surgical specialties.
Top MD Specializations in 2026
- MD Internal Medicine
- MD Pediatrics
- MD Radiology (Highest demand)
- MD Dermatology
- MD Psychiatry
- MD Emergency Medicine
- MD Anaesthesia
- MD General Medicine
Duration: 3 years
Careers After MD: Specialist doctor, consultant, hospital physician, academic lecturer.
Salary Range: ₹15–₹45 lakhs per year (India); significantly higher abroad.

MS (Master of Surgery)
MS is ideal for students interested in surgical streams.
Top MS Specializations
- MS General Surgery
- MS Orthopedics
- MS Ophthalmology
- MS ENT
- MS Obstetrics & Gynecology
Duration: 3 years
Career Scope: Surgeon, consultant, specialist surgeon.
Salary: ₹20–₹60 lakhs/year.

DNB (Diplomate of National Board)
DNB is equivalent to MD/MS and recognized worldwide.
Popular DNB Streams
- DNB Radiology
- DNB General Surgery
- DNB Pediatrics
- DNB Anesthesiology
Why Choose DNB?
- Accepted in India and abroad
- Good for students who target corporate hospitals
PG Diploma Courses After MBBS
Diploma programs are suitable for students who missed NEET PG seats or want short-term specialization.
Top Diploma Programs
- Diploma in Anesthesia
- Diploma in Ophthalmology
- Diploma in Orthopedics
- Diploma in Pediatrics
Duration: 2 years
Scope: Assistant consultants, junior specialists.

MCh & DM (Super Specialization Courses)
After MD/MS, doctors can pursue super-specialty courses.
Top DM Courses
- DM Cardiology
- DM Gastroenterology
- DM Neurology
- DM Endocrinology
Top MCh Courses
- MCh Neurosurgery
- MCh Plastic Surgery
- MCh Urology
- MCh Surgical Oncology
Salary: ₹30 lakhs to ₹1 crore+ per year.
Non-Clinical Courses After MBBS (2026 Trends)
These are great for students who do not prefer direct patient care.
MPH – Master of Public Health
Perfect for roles in public health organizations, NGOs, WHO, research institutes.
Duration: 2 years
Career Areas: Epidemiology, global health, research, community medicine.
MHA – Master of Hospital Administration
Ideal for students who want to enter hospital management.
Job Roles:
- Hospital Administrator
- Healthcare Manager
- Corporate hospital leadership
Salary: ₹8–₹30 lakhs per year.
MBA Healthcare Management
Designed for leadership careers in healthcare companies, insurance, pharma, med-tech.
Scope: Hospital director, healthcare consultant, operations head.
MSc Medical Courses After MBBS
Good for students interested in teaching or research.
Popular MSc Programs
- MSc Anatomy
- MSc Microbiology
- MSc Physiology
- MSc Pharmacology
- MSc Clinical Research
Career: Lecturer, medical researcher, pharma scientist.

Comparison Table
| Course | Duration |
Salary Range |
Best For |
| MD | 3 yrs | ₹15–45L | Physicians |
| MS | 3 yrs | ₹20–60L | Surgeons |
| DNB | 3 yrs | ₹12–30L | Corporate hospitals |
| Diploma | 2 yrs | ₹8–15L | Basic specialization |
| Fellowship | 1 yrs | ₹10–30L | Fast specialization |
| MPH | 2 yrs | ₹8–20L | NGO/Research |
| MHA | 2 yrs | ₹8–30L | Hospital admin |
| MBA Healthcare | 2 yrs | ₹6–15L | Corporate careers |
| MSc | 2 yrs | ₹6–15L | Teachers/Researchers |
| International PG | varies | ₹50L–₹1Cr+ | Global careers |
